HashIdentity.LimitedStructural<'T> Function (F#)

Implements a structural hash that is limited to hashing a fixed number of elements.

Namespace/Module Path: Microsoft.FSharp.Collections.HashIdentity

Assembly: FSharp.Core (in FSharp.Core.dll)

// Signature:
LimitedStructural : int -> IEqualityComparer<'T> (requires equality)

// Usage:
LimitedStructural limit

Parameters

  • limit
    Type: int

    The maximum number of elements to hash.

Return Value

An object that implements IEqualityComparer using the limited hash.

Remarks

Structural hashing recursively composes a hash of a structural object by combining the hashes of each of its constituent elements. So, if you have a list composed of 20,000 elements, the hashes of each element will be composed into the hash of the list.

To save time and mitigate the risk of a stack overflow while hashing, the limited hash allows you to specify an upper bound on the number of items you would like to consider when constructing a hash over structured data. So, if you are hashing a list of 20,000 elements, you can just use its first 18 elements.

LimitedStructural uses the limitedHash function.
